Common Home Repair Issues in Perth
1. Plumbing Problems
- Leaking taps and toilets are the most common complaints.
- Hard water in some areas of Perth can cause mineral buildup, leading to blockages.
- Burst pipes during cooler months can create unexpected emergencies.
2. Electrical Repairs
- Faulty wiring and old switchboards pose fire risks.
- Power outages due to outdated electrical systems are frequent in older Perth homes.
3. Carpentry and Structural Repairs
- Weatherboards and fences often need repair due to Perth’s hot summers and stormy winters.
- Cabinets, wardrobes, and doors may warp or loosen over time.
4. Roof and Gutter Issues
- Perth receives over 730 mm of rainfall annually, making gutters essential.
- Blocked gutters can cause leaks, mold, and even foundation damage.
5. Gyprock and Wall Repairs
- Cracks from natural settlement or humidity are common.
- Damaged walls affect both appearance and insulation.
Why Preventive Maintenance Saves You Money
A well-known saying in property management is: “A stitch in time saves nine.” This applies perfectly to home maintenance.
According to a report from the Australian Bureau of Statistics, households spend an average of $1,500 to $2,500 per year on reactive repairs—but homeowners who invest in regular preventive maintenance save up to 30% annually.
For example:
- Replacing a damaged gutter early ($200–$400) prevents roof leaks that could cost thousands in water damage.
- Fixing a squeaky door hinge ($50) avoids long-term frame repairs that could cost $500+.
DIY Repairs vs Professional Services
When DIY Works
- Painting walls or fences.
- Replacing a showerhead.
- Basic garden and yard maintenance.
When to Call the Professionals
- Electrical work (strictly regulated in WA).
- Plumbing that involves pipe replacement
- Carpentry or structural repairs requiring expertise.
- Roof inspections and repairs.
While DIY saves money upfront, professional services ensure safety, quality, and longevity of the repair.

Seasonal Home Maintenance Checklist for Perth
Summer
- Service air conditioning systems.
- Inspect outdoor furniture and decks.
- Check reticulation systems for the garden.
Winter
- Clean gutters and downpipes.
- Inspect roofing for leaks.
- Seal gaps and cracks to improve insulation.
Spring
- Fresh coat of paint for fences or walls.
- Deep clean outdoor areas.
- Trim trees before storm season.
Autumn
- Check plumbing before cooler months.
- Prepare heating systems.
- Inspect and repair windows and doors.
Sustainable Home Maintenance in Perth
Sustainability is becoming a major focus for Perth homeowners. By choosing eco-friendly repair options, you can reduce your bills and environmental impact.
Examples include:
- Installing LED lighting (up to 80% more efficient than traditional bulbs).
- Using water-saving plumbing fixtures (reduces water bills by up to 25%).
- Choosing recycled or sustainable timber for carpentry work.
